Special Kids Network
1-800-986-4550
The Special Kids Network links callers to a broad range of services for children with special health care needs. These include health care products, training, recreation and leisure, social services, counseling, support, advocacy, and therapy.
PA Recreation and Leisure
1-800-986-4550
This help line serves individuals with disabilities as an information and referral help line to connect individuals with disabilities with accessible, inclusive recreational activities. By calling the Recreation and Leisure Line individuals can receive information and referrals on available activities and facilities that are accessible and inclusive.
Lead Information Line
1-800-440-LEAD (5323)
The Lead Information Line offers personal help and written information to parents, physicians, contractors and homeowners about lead poisoning and its prevention and control.
Brain Injury
1-866-412-4755
This information and referral clearinghouse can provide information and resources about the condition and treatment of brain injuries, protection and advocacy services, local support groups, as well as links to other websites. Offers referrals to community and State resources in addition to the Brain Injury Association of Pennsylvania.
